Land Trust Alliance
Local and regional land trusts, organized as charitable organizations under federal tax laws, are directly involved in conserving land for its natural, recreational, scenic, historical and productive values.

Canoe Tennessee
CanoeTennessee.com is a very helpful website for water-lovers. David Rose takes you on his journey through the Tennessee River Gorge via canoe. His beautiful photographs, helpful gear checklist, and the interactive map of the Tennessee River Blueway is a one-stop website filled with handy information for anyone who plans to travel the Blueway via canoe or kayak. Even if you are not going on a canoe trip anytime soon, check out the site for the amazing wilflife photos.

The Cumberland Plateau Nature Trail
With three tours available—the Northern Tour, Central Tour and Southern Tour—the Cumberland Plateau Nature Trail is designed to guide you through the very best hiking and nature viewing in Tennessee’s Cumberland Plateau region. Offering diverse experiences—from city greenways to vast wilderness areas—the sites in each tour provide a unique and satisfying look at the area’s wonders.
